What material makes up earth's inner core outer core and mantle?

The Earth's inner core is mostly made up of solid iron and nickel. The outer core is predominantly made of liquid iron and nickel. The mantle is composed of solid rock, primarily silicate minerals rich in magnesium and iron.

What does Jupiter have on?

Jupiter's core is made up of rock, metal, and hydrogen compounds.Jupiter's outer core is made up of metallic hydrogen.Jupiter's mantle is made up of liquid hydrogen and helium.Jupiter's cloud tops are made up of hydrogen and helium.Jupiter's atmosphere is made up of 89.8% hydrogen and 10.2% helium with a little bit of methane and ammonia.

Why is the Earth core made out of metal?

The Earth's core is made mostly of iron and nickel because these elements were present in the materials that formed the Earth, and they sank to the center due to the planet's early molten state and gravitational forces. This concentration of heavy metals create the dense and metallic core at the center of the Earth.
